Wizards of Waverly Place Review - Game-Boyz

Game-Boyz: Make no doubt about it; my daughter loves her Disney TV shows. Whether it be Zack and Cody, Hannah Montana, Cory in the House or Wizards of Waverly Place; she watches every new episode usually more than once. Unfortunately when it comes to the Disney DS games based on the aforementioned shows, my daughter has been disappointed more often than not. So when Wizards of Waverly Place for the DS arrived, I reluctantly handed the game over to my daughter hoping this Disney game could buck the trend. Much to my surprise she really enjoyed the game but it wasn't too long before she 'hit a wall' and stopped playing the game altogether.

Avault: Wizards of Waverly Place Review

If you're a huge fan of the series, Wizards of Waverly Place might be worth a look. Even so, don't go in expecting any real story or clever dialogue. This game has very little to do with the series, and is simply banking on its name to sell an otherwise lackluster game.

IGN: Wizards of Waverly Place Review

Black Lantern Studios failed to capture the spunky spirit of the show and the length and storyline leave a lot to be desired. A mere four and a half hours into the experience and IGN's dreams of reenacting more Wizards madness were shattered. Add that disappointment to the hit-or-miss mini-games and you've got one underwhelming game.
